Athletes - John Shelby


John T. Shelby (born February 23, 1958, in Lexington, Kentucky) was a Major League Baseball player from 1981-1991.

Over his 11 year career he played with three different teams: the Baltimore Orioles (1981-1987), Los Angeles Dodgers (1987-1990), and Detroit Tigers (1990-1991).

Shelby was a member of two World Series winning teams, the Baltimore Orioles (1983) and Los Angeles Dodgers (1988).
